A Sneak Peak Into The Upcoming Era Of E-commerce

Contributor by Contributor
June 17, 2019
in Artificial Intelligence
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Online commerce has made a huge impact on the lives of people. Especially if we talk about 2019, then there’s a clear impact, progress, and growth of this niche which we can clearly see.

If we take an instance of 2017, then according to one report at that specific moment of the time, there were only 54-55 million shoppers.

Later on, this digit reached to 63 million in the year of 2018. In the same way, the numbers got increased in the present year also. Well, the reason behind this is the betterment which these online commerce platforms are offering to the online shoppers.

  1. E-commerce for B2B Is Exploding

If you’re the person, who thinks that E-commerce is for B2C brands only then let me, please correct you over there. As you’re completely wrong in this case.

Today, B2B businesses are also leveraging expected e-commerce trends, too. In fact, it is even being predicted that B2B e-commerce trades are expected to expend $7.4 trillion in the upcoming years.

In a recent study of 400 B2B companies, it was founded that more than 85% of the people are convinced enough to share their personal information with the provider website.

This is something which is actually further proving the growth of the e-commerce industry in B2B industries.

E-commerce personalization works wonders for B2B shoppers as well. The research found that 50 percent of B2B buyers desired personalization when searching for online suppliers with whom to build relationships.

  1. More Custom Retail Experiences

Are you the person who thinks that the growth of the e-commerce industry has impacted the growth of brick and mortar shops? If yes, then it is time to think about it again.

However, there are lots of big-box shops which are getting ruined, and the reason for all of them is the same, retail experiences though this is just one reality of this sector.

Although chatbots, product technology, and physical technology experience are all working all-the-way together in the same case, still there is a lot more which will be required.

By considering real-experience so much, many brands are attempting to create immersive retail practices to drive traffic, get more sales, and promote long-lasting client relations.

In fact, to work for the same cause, Amazon is working with their best efforts, which is soon going to overcome this issue.

With lots of hosting providers to pick from and e-commerce platforms on the rise, businesses are creating e-commerce experiences in a retail store via digital kiosks.

Once a user engages with the digital kiosk, it will automatically present a user with the product suggestions that would be relevant to his or her own choices.

  1. AI, Assistants, and Chatbots

Nowadays, robots (AI and chatbots) have invaded e-commerce stores. These Chatbots and AI are all-together working to enhance the shopping experience of the user.

AI assistants can manage lots of work typically assigned to a human, like managing inquiries and a lot more.

Mostly, these digital companions will work out on different processes, which will free you up with the time, which you could otherwise invest in working towards your goals.

Well, chatbots are designed to fulfill the needs of the customer, no matter if it requires solving a cut more query or discussing any complaint or issue.

These Chatbots and AI are intelligent enough that they learn from the prior conversation of yours and strive to offer you the best solution, which is entirely customer-centric.
